Los Leones will be looking to kick off 2024 with a victory at the Ramón Sánchez-Pizjuán

After a two-week long festive break, Athletic Club return to LaLiga action with a classic fixture as they travel to Andalusia to face Sevilla FC.

The Lions will need to be at their best. With Sevilla in 15th place on 16 points (two above the drop zone), new head coach Quique Sánchez Flores will be desperate for his side to start climbing away from a potential relegation battle.

Meanwhile, the Zurigorri will be looking to pick up where they left off in 2023 by extending their eight-match unbeaten streak in the league.

Team News
Valverde named a 23-man squad for the clash in Seville

Yeray Álvarez and Dani García remain sidelined, while Iñaki Williams is away on international duty with Ghana.

Oscar de Marcos and Iñigo Ruiz de Galarreta have recovered from their respective injuries and are back in the fold, and young Bilbao Athletic midfielder Mikel Jauregizar keeps his place in the squad.

The Opponents

Head coach: Quique Sánchez Flores

Sevilla have turned to a season operator in Sánchez Flores - the club's third manager of the season - as they look to revive their campaign. 

The former Valencia and Real Madrid player, has worked at a number of top clubs in several different leagues since he took his first job, at Getafe, in 2004/05. In total he has now led five different LaLiga clubs, including three seperate spells with Getafe.

His managerial honours include a Europa League and a UEFA Super Cup at Atlético Madrid as well as a Portugues League Cup with Benfica.

Top goalscorer: Youssef En-Nesyri

The Moroccan forward is now in his fifth season at the Ramón Sánchez-Pizjuán. He joined Sevilla from Leganés halfway through the 2019/20 campaign and has gone on to score 40 goals in 127 LaLiga appearances.

En-Nesyri has stood out for Morocco at international level, famously scoring a winner against Portugal to help the Atlas Lions reach the semi-finals at the 2022 World Cup in Qatar.

Recent form: DLLWL

Just three wins from the first half of the season have left Sevilla in 16th place, only three points above the relegation places. A previous change of manager didn't provide the boost hoped for, but Sánchez Flores' first two games in charge have seen the Andalusians beat Granada 0-3 away and lose 1-0 to Atlético Madrid in their rescheduled Matchday 4 fixture.

Previous Meetings
We've faced the Andalusian outft a total of 158 times in LaLiga, registering 61 wins, 31 draws and 66 losses. The first ever top-flight meeting was a 4-0 victory for the Lions back in the 1934/35 campaign.

Away days in Seville tend to be tough for the Zurigorri. From 79 LaLiga visits to the Andalusian city, Athletic have picked up 11 victories, 21 wins and 47 defeats.

Our last five trips to the Ramón Sánchez-Pizjuán are indicative of how difficult these clashes can be, with one win, two draws and two losses.

Los Rojiblancos' most recent win in Seville came two seasons ago. Iñaki Williams made sure the Lions took all three points with a 90th-minute goal.
